JRST: Journal of Reaserch inScience Teaching Vol. 53 Issue 3 March 2016

Abd-El-Khalick, Fouad - Personal Name; Zeidler, Dana L. - Personal Name;

CONTENTS

Research Articles
- To customize or not to customize? Exploring science teacher customization in an online lesson portal: Joshua Littenberg-Tobias, Elham Beheshti and Carolyn Staudt
Published online 12 January 2016 in Wiley Online Library
- Early experiences and integration in the persistence of first-generation college students in STEM and non-STEM majors: Sandra L. Dika and Mark M. D’ Amico
Published online 22 December 2015 in Wiley Online Library
- Student positions on the relationship between evolution and creation: What kinds of changes occur and for what reasons?: Pratchayapong Yarsi and Rebecca Mancy
Published online 22 December 2015 in Wiley Online Library
- Investigating optimal learning moments in U.S. and finnish science classes: Barbara Schneider, Joseph Krajcik, Jari Lavonen, Katariina Salmela-Aro, Michael Broda, Justina Spicer, Justin Bruner, Julia Moeller, Janna Linnansaari, Kalle Juuti, and Jaana Viljaranta

Research Articles Accepted for Publication Under the Prior Editorial Team
- Interacting with a suite of educative features: Elementary science teachers' use of educative curriculum materials: Anna Maria Arias, Amber Schultz Bismack, Elizabeth A. Davis, and Annemarie Sullivan Palincsar
Published online 2 May 2015 in Wiley Online Library
- Families support their children's success in science learning by influencing interest and self-efficacy : Li Sha, Christian Schunn, Meghan Bathgate, and Adar Ben-Eliyahu
Published online 8 May 2015 in Wiley Online Library
- Learning from one's own teaching: New science teachers analyzing their practice through classroom observation cycles: Jennifer Ceven McNally
Published online 26 May 2015 in Wiley Online Library
- Scaffolding learning by modelling: The effects of partially worked-out models: Yvonne G. Mulder, Lars Bollen, Ton de Jong, and Ard W. Lazonder
Published online 9 June 2015 in Wiley Online Library
